There are no networks, no deductibles, and no insurance claims. Instead, members act as self-pay patients while supporting one another through a shared crowdfunding pool. Routine and minor medical expenses are paid directly by the member at discounted rates, while larger costs are submitted to the community for financial support.

Care Advocates guide members through the complexities of the healthcare system—helping them find affordable providers, understand billing, and negotiate charges. Through its mobile app, members can also access virtual care and discounted prescriptions, all with complete transparency.
